Why do people get charges like this from Retell AI?
- Subscriptions: Many users report being automatically enrolled in a subscription service after a free trial period without clear notifications or reminders.
- Purchases: Charges may arise from one-time purchases such as premium features or additional credits for enhanced services.
- Usage Fees: Users might incur charges based on the usage of AI tools or models beyond a free tier, particularly for high-volume tasks.
- Upgrades: Some users felt they were charged for upgrading their account or accessing advanced features they may not have intended to purchase.
- Inactivity Fees: A few threads mentioned unexpected charges related to account inactivity or maintenance fees for non-active accounts.
- Family or Group Accounts: Additional charges may come from shared accounts if someone else in the group makes a purchase or uses paid features.
- Payment Processing Errors: Instances of double charges or unauthorized transactions due to glitches in payment processing systems.
If I see this charge, what should I do?
If you see this charge and arenāt expecting it, you have various options.
First, try to contact the retellai.com via one of the support methods we listed below and inquire about the charge. See if they will refund it and cancel any associated subscriptions you might have.
If the retellai.com refused to issue a refund or you cannot get in touch with the company, call your bank or financial institution and open a credit card dispute. Record screenshot evidence from your prior conversations with retellai.com, and use that to open your credit card dispute. Tell your bank or credit card issuer that you do not recognize the charge and do not recall signing up for the service.
